Using colored sand to create art is a visually captivating and tactile form of expression. Artists utilize this medium to craft intricate designs, vibrant landscapes, and textured masterpieces. Here’s a description of the process: * Selecting Sand: Artists typically choose sand in various colors, which may be natural or artificially dyed. These colors can range from earthy tones like beige, brown, and terracotta to vibrant hues such as red, blue, green, and yellow. * Preparation: Before starting the artwork, the artist needs to prepare the surface. This can be a canvas, board, glass, or any other suitable material. Some artists prefer to work on adhesive-backed paper, allowing them to peel off the paper once the artwork is complete. * Design Planning: Planning the design is crucial, especially for intricate patterns or detailed scenes. Artists may sketch their design lightly on the surface using a pencil or chalk. This serves as a guideline during the sand application process. * Applying Adhesive: Once the design is outlined, the artist applies adhesive to the areas where sand will be placed. This adhesive can be a clear glue or spray adhesive, depending on the artist’s preference. It’s essential to work in small sections to prevent the adhesive from drying out before the sand is applied. * Adding Sand: Using a small spoon, brush, or even fingers, the artist carefully sprinkles or pours colored sand onto the adhesive-covered areas. They may use different techniques to achieve various effects, such as layering colors, blending gradients, or creating textured patterns. * Shaping and Blending: Artists often use tools like brushes, toothpicks, or even their fingers to shape the sand, blend colors, or create intricate details. They can manipulate the sand to form curves, lines, and textures, bringing their artistic vision to life. * Finishing Touches: Once the design is complete, the artist may gently tap or press down on the sand to ensure it adheres firmly to the surface. Any excess sand can be carefully brushed away. Some artists also apply a protective sealant or varnish to preserve the artwork and enhance its colors. * Displaying the Artwork: Colored sand art can be displayed in various ways, depending on the artist’s preference and the intended setting. It can be framed under glass to protect it from dust and damage, showcased in a shadow box, or even poured into glass containers to create decorative sculptures or layered sand jars. Colored sand can be used in various art forms, including painting, sculpture, collage, and mixed media. Its versatility allows artists to explore different techniques and styles, from creating detailed landscapes to abstract compositions.
Sand adds texture and depth to artwork, creating visually interesting surfaces that engage the senses. Artists can manipulate the sand to achieve different effects, such as smooth gradients, rough textures, or intricate patterns.
Colored sand comes in a wide range of hues, from natural earth tones to vibrant shades. This allows artists to experiment with color combinations and create vibrant, eye-catching artwork.
Once properly sealed, colored sand art can be durable and long-lasting. This makes it suitable for both indoor and outdoor display, as it can withstand environmental factors such as sunlight, humidity, and temperature fluctuations.
Working with colored sand can be educational for artists, allowing them to explore concepts such as color theory, texture, composition, and spatial awareness. It can also be used as a teaching tool in schools and art classes to engage students in hands-on, sensory experiences.
